Oct 19, 2023 · Sedimentary rocks can be organized into two categories. The first is detrital rock, which comes from the erosion and accumulation of rock fragments, sediment, or other materials—categorized in total as detritus, or debris. The other is chemical rock, produced from the dissolution and precipitation of minerals. Sandstone is a clastic sedimentary rock comprised of sand-sized particles about .1 to .2 mm in size. It is usually tan, brown, or reddish in color, and often (but not always) displays noticeable layers. The sand grains are most often made of quartz, cemented together by calcite or silica.

If they do not have dominant directions, in general, then they can be treated as isotropic, such as sandstone and limestone. Otherwise, they could be anisotropic, such as slate and shale. However, the most sedimentary rocks are stratified. Limestone is a sedimentary rock composed principally of the mineral calcite (CaCO 3). It may be easily identified by the application of a drop of cold dilute hydrochloric acid, which causes the calcite particles to effervesce freely. The main difference between limestone and marble is that limestone is a sedimentary rock, typically composed of calcium carbonate fossils, and marble is a metamorphic rock. Limestone forms when shells, sand, and mud are deposited at the bottom of oceans and lakes and over time solidify into rock. Marble forms when sedimentary limestone is ...
